Alex Michaelides

Nascido: September 04, 1977 – Nicosia, Nicosia District, Cyprus

Alex Michaelides is a Cypriot-British author and screenwriter known for psychological thrillers that blend suspense, trauma, and classical motifs. He rose to international prominence with The Silent Patient, a multimillion-copy bestseller translated widely, and followed it with The Maidens and The Fury, reinforcing his reputation for twist-driven contemporary crime fiction.

Biografia e Jornada do Autor

Alex Michaelides is a British-Cypriot novelist and screenwriter whose rise to prominence came through psychological suspense rather than a conventional online-writer path. Born in Cyprus in 1977, he grew up between Greek and English cultural influences, a dual inheritance that later shaped both the classical references and the emotional atmosphere of his fiction. After moving to the United Kingdom, he studied English literature at Trinity College, Cambridge, and then pursued screenwriting at the American Film Institute in Los Angeles. Before his breakthrough as a novelist, he worked in film and television and also spent time in a psychiatric setting, an experience that sharpened his interest in trauma, silence, obsession, and the hidden motives that drive human behavior. Those strands would become central to his fiction.
